About this role:

The St. George Cardiovascular team is comprised of 28 Cardiologists and APPs. As an Advanced Practice Provider for this team, you would work in a pod of 4-5 providers to provide top-notch care and patient experience. Here are some highlights you can expect.

  • This is an outpatient and inpatient position working at our cardiology clinic and hospital in St. George, UT
  • You would work in the clinic 4 ten hour day shifts Mon-Fri with your day off being determined by the department
  • Approximately 1 week every 2 months, you would work in the hospital for the full week including the weekend
  • There is no overnight call for this position

What youll bring:

We hire people, not words on paper. But we also expect excellence, which is why we require:

  • Must have or be eligible for a current and unrestricted NP or PA Utah License
  • APRN or PA-C degree from an accredited program
  • AANP or NCCPA certification
  • BLS and ACLS certification, and DEA
  • Minimum of 2 years of experience as an Advanced Practitioner, preferably in Cardiology

Life in St. George, Utah

St. George islocatedwithin sculpted red rock desert valleys that are nestled below pine covered mountain peaks. The area is surrounded by multiple national parks and is a top destination with its year-round warm weather and favorable climate, golf courses, outdoor recreationopportunitiesand collegiate town environment.St. George is in the top ten fastest growing cities in the United States with a population of 171,000 according toBusinessInsider.com.? To accommodate the rapid growth,St. GeorgeRegional Medical Center is a level II trauma center, recently expanding to 336 inpatient beds, has more than 320 physicians on staff, serves southern Utah, northern Arizona, and Nevada.??
